Description

This property is no longer available to rent or to buy. This description is from March 16, 2024
RARE FIND! Total remodel in prestigious area with a perfect blend of charm, character and upscale convenient modern lifestyle updates! Parklike oversized corner lot on a culdesac showcases mature trees , privacy, sprinkler system and a shady private 10X30 patio for your outdoor events. Ideal location near miles of Highline Canal trails, close to Milliken Park with its soccer fields and playgounds. Enjoy close proximity to shopping, historic downtown Littleton, restaurants and Light Rail. Award winning Littleton schools! Beautiful main floor living plus professionally finished updated basement space! Remodeled dream gourmet kitchen with quartz countertops/white cabinetry/classy tile flooring/new appliances. Gleaming refinished real wood flooring throughout main level. Stunning antique fireplace front accents mid-century modern appeal in the sunny spacious living room. Hall bath offers quartz counters/double vanity/decorator tile. Fresh designer paint throughout! Additional living space in the basement offers gracious family room with cozy wood burning brick fireplace will be the heart of fun events for your family. Two oversized basement bedrooms, one with an egress window, plus lovely remodeled bath, fun built-in center for office or hobby area and lots of storage and closet space. Plush new carpet! Updated baseboards/trim/doors/lighting/plumbing/electrical. New energy efficient windows. Fully fenced. Rare 3 car oversized garage. Handy main floor laundry plus space in the basement for laundry if you prefer. New boiler for years of a low maintenance comfortable heating source. Lots of good storage. Unique one of a kind mid-century modern home with all the charm and updates you will love. Owner carry terms available at 6 1/2%! call listing agent for details. New roof! 6255 S Grant Street, Centennial, CO 80121 is a 4 bedroom, 2 bathroom, 2,914 sqft single-family home built in 1960. This property is not currently available for sale. 6255 S Grant Street was last sold on Mar 15, 2024 for $759,950 (0% higher than the asking price of $759,950).
